Introduction of Samsung
For over 70 years, Samsung has been dedicated to making a better world through diverse businesses that today span advanced technology, semiconductors, skyscraper and plant construction, petrochemicals, fashion, medicine, finance, hotels, and more. Our flagship company, Samsung Electronics, leads the global market in high-tech electronics manufacturing and digital media.(Samsung, 2012)
Through innovative, reliable products and services; talented people; a responsible approach to business and global citizenship; and collaboration with our partners and customers, Samsung is taking the world in imaginative new directions.. (Samsung , 2012)

    Samsung Electronics Company, henceforth called “Samsung” in this case, was established in 1969 to manufacture black-and-white TV sets. In 1974, Samsung, which was a producer of low-end consumer electronics, purchased Korea Semiconductor Company and began its semiconductor industry. Under the leadership of the chairman of Samsung Group, Kun He Lee, Samsung has risen, with a remarkable speed, to become the world’s leading memory producer, ranking 2nd just behind Intel. Meanwhile, Samsung used the earnings from memory division to invest in various technology products like mobile phones, liquid crystal displays and so on. These businesses made Samsung generate the second-largest net profit of any electronic company outside the US.…

    Samsung Group was established in Deagu, Korea in 1938 by chairman Byung- Chull Lee with only 30,000 won as capital (Samsung, 2013) and it became the principle largest Korean company immediately with exactly a quarter of total corporate Korean profits (Kotler and Armstrong, 2012, p.309). Over 30 years later, Samsung Electronics was founded under the name of Samsung- Sanyo Electronics and the first TV was produced. It has become well-known since 1980 when Samsung penetrated into international market with a large number of new products such as recorders, air conditioners and PCs. In 1992, Samsung developed mobile phone systems which were basis for growths, and they had changed marketing strategy “top- to- bottom” in order to become an Electronics innovator by one year later (ibid). The span of the period from 2000 to present has been the golden age of Samsung with its position as the market leader in 13 electronic products (Samsung, 2013). It is considered as rank 3rd in most innovative companies in the world today (Shaughnessy, 2013a).…
